Poole Wheelers return to the Track

Track racing is making a steady re-emergence amongst Poole Wheelers riders as a result of the efforts of our resident British Cycling coach (to be) Graham Hurst. Track sessions have proved to be very popular down at Calshot overlooking the Solent. Send me many photos guys and girls

Track Update   23rd February 2008. 

Although the numbers of seniors and juniors were down on previous sessions only 12 which included 3 who had never ridden a fixed wheel before let alone Calshot track, we once again had a good morning.

As well as having some hard sessions such as gaining a lap we had some more gentle exercises where the new riders were paired up with more experienced riders this proved a great success with all riders able to comfortably ride in a group up to 4 a breast and to ride in-between a 2 lines of riders by the end of the session. Particular mention has to be given to Ellie Gilham (age 12) up to now Ellie has only ridden in  12’s and under group but was given the opportunity to ride in approx half of the senior/junior exercisers which she did very well.

We finished with another try at Shaun’s game for the experienced riders which worked very well with riders working hard and together which was very encouraging to see. 

In the last hour we had 6 turn up for the 12’s and under, plus we let the 3 14 year old girls (2 of which had never ridden the track before and 1 who had only ridden once before) join in to help and encourage them as well as getting some more track time / experience themselves.

As well as the usual warm up and skills  exercises we had some handicap sprint races which were fought very hard plus they all had a go at a timed lap the results of which are below. 

We now only have 1 more session booked this winter which will be on the 22nd March and this will incorporate a club track championship- remember to be there

Track Update     26th  Jan 2008.

We had another good day on the track with 18 seniors/Juniors riding plus another 5 in the 12 and under session afterwards. 

We did not have any timed laps or races today so no results as such to publish but we worked more on group riding and bunch riding skills and etiquette. All the inexperienced track riders seem to improving greatly which is very encouraging as we intend to have a club track championship at our last session on 22nd March. 

We also introduced group session  affectionately know as Shaun’s game (named after Shaun Wallace) for the first time, this is as close to racing without racing as you can get, although not a complete success, most riders that rode grasped the principle but this is something we will have to work on next time.  

After this session finished at 12.30pm 5 riders Mark Moss, John Vinson, Adam D’Arcy-Wykes, Graham Hurst and Rebecca Hurst plus Dave (the taxi) Moss rushed off to Newport to joint up with the Palmer Park Velo to ride in their session at 4.00pm.

None of us had ridden Newport before and what a great experience it was. Mark and John in particular enjoyed themselves and this could be seen by the beaming smiles on their faces.

A long day with lots of travelling but well worth it.
